In late January our GOC trailer was stolen as well as personal property from buildings on the site.
We have exhausted the few leads on our own and in cooperation with local law enforcement agencies. At this point, we move from recovery to replacement.
THIS DOES NOT JEOPARDIZE GOC 2026
We have throughout the years blessed each other and been blessed in return both in participation at GOC and in the generosity through fundraising functions such as the raffle and T-shirts. Each penny has been managed well and goes right back into GOC. We had planned and were prepared to begin to replace some items that were worn and nearing the end of their usefulness, but obviously had not anticipated a complete replacement, including the trailer itself.
GOC has touched the lives of so many over the years, some have already heard of this incident and offered assistance and contributions.
We are grateful and come together in community to not only support GOC but each other and what this unique event does, has done, and will continue to do into the future.
